Shanklin is a traditional seaside resort, with amusement arcades, gift shops, and a great range of eateries. Potter around the charming Old Village, with its idyllic thatched cottages, before following the tree-lined Shanklin Chine down to the sandy beach and esplanade. The bustling coastal town of Ventnor also has plenty to see and do, with a delightful sand and shingle beach and beautiful botanic gardens, as well as delicious fish and chip shops and ice cream parlours.
